Process Posted March 11, 2022 Share Posted March 11, 2022 I wonder if McDermott would change his tune on using a rotation if we were to sign an elite end like Jones. I already hate the rotation.... if we signed Jones and I watched McDermott sub him out for AJ 50% of the snaps I'd be furious. "Jones would certainly slot in at starting defensive end opposite Greg Rousseau, but he’s consistently played more than 84% of his team’s snaps on defense. In Buffalo, he would get more of a breather than that, as the Bills love to rotate. Jerry Hughes led all defensive ends on the Bills at just under 52% of the snaps a year ago." 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Hapless Bills Fan Posted March 11, 2022 Share Posted March 11, 2022 2 minutes ago, BillsDude said: If you want to see where in general Chandler Jones wants to play, click below. https://www.azcardinals.com/news/chandler-jones-says-future-will-be-determined-by-who-maximizes-chandler-jones Could just be me, but when a guy says "it's not about money at all", I think it's a lot about money Quote "To be completely honest, it's not about money at all," Jones said. "Where I am in my career, I've gotten contracts, I've gotten the Super Bowl, but I think scheme is huge. Or for me, winning more championships. I'll say it again, it's not about money. I will say I want to go to a place that maximizes my talents. There have been times in my career where I'd say I caught myself out of position. I do take the blame, but at the same time it's like, 'Hey, should I have been doing that?' I have enough comfort where I am in my career and this age to say that. "Where does Chandler Jones become Chandler Jones? Where can he maximize his talent? I think there were a few times you saw it this season, where you were like, who is this guy? Week 1, five sacks ... so you see flashes of it, and I'm pretty sure there were times where people said, 'Why did it disappear, where is it going?' Not to put it on just the game plan -- I'm sure there were a lot of different things that goes into it. But again, going into free agency, what team maximizes Chandler Jones' talents?"
